How to Effectively Identify the Key Causes of Poor Lawn Drainage

Lawn Drainage Services in South Vancouver: A lawn exhibiting puddles and waterlogged regions due to soil compaction and improper grading during heavy rainfall.

Experiencing poor drainage in your lawn not only diminishes the aesthetic appeal of your outdoor space but also jeopardises the overall health of your grass. In regions like South Vancouver, the unique topographical features and climatic conditions exacerbate these drainage challenges. A prevalent issue leading to ineffective drainage is soil compaction, where soil particles are tightly pressed together, significantly reducing pore space and impeding water infiltration. Furthermore, improper grading occurs when the surface of the lawn does not slope appropriately, failing to direct water away from structures and into designated drainage areas. Given the frequent occurrence of excessive rainfall in South Vancouver, the soil can quickly become saturated, resulting in unsightly puddles and waterlogged ground.

Homeowners frequently grapple with the negative consequences of these drainage concerns, which can manifest in various damaging ways. Recognising these underlying factors is essential for effective remediation. It is crucial for homeowners to acknowledge that ignoring drainage problems can lead to more severe complications, such as the proliferation of mould, the emergence of lawn diseases, and even potential structural damage to adjacent buildings.

What Are the Early Signs Indicating Drainage Problems?

Early identification of drainage issues can save homeowners a considerable amount of time, effort, and financial resources in the long run. Numerous visible indicators suggest that your lawn may be struggling with drainage difficulties. A classic sign is the presence of water pooling in specific areas following a rainstorm. Another symptom is the existence of soggy patches where grass remains damp long after the rain has ceased. Moreover, yellowing grass often indicates that roots are suffering from excessive moisture conditions.

To catch these problems early, homeowners should undertake routine visual inspections of their lawns, particularly after heavy rainfall. Key indicators to monitor include:

  • Water pooling in low-lying areas.
  • Soil that remains muddy or damp for extended periods.
  • Grass that appears yellow or shows signs of wilting.
  • Swelling or bulging in specific sections of the lawn.
  • Visible erosion or washouts on slopes.
  • Unusual insect activity or signs of fungal growth.

Being vigilant about these signs can lead to timely interventions, preventing further damage and promoting a flourishing lawn.

How to Effectively Identify Drainage Problems on Your Property?

Identifying drainage issues requires a discerning eye and some investigative effort. Start by carefully examining your lawn after heavy rains for any standing water or overly saturated areas, which may signify underlying problems. Utilising a soil probe can provide valuable insights into soil compaction. When you insert the probe into the soil, observe how easily it penetrates; difficulty in penetration likely indicates compaction.

If issues persist, consider consulting a professional for a comprehensive assessment. Homeowners should be prepared to discuss observed issues and any previous attempts to rectify the situation. Taking a proactive approach not only saves time but also allows drainage specialists to tailor their solutions to meet your unique needs effectively.

Understanding the Various Types of Lawn Drainage Systems

How Do French Drains Operate for Effective Water Management?

French drains rank among the most effective solutions for managing excess water in lawns. This system comprises a trench filled with gravel and a perforated pipe that redirects water away from problematic areas. The design enables water to flow into the pipe through its perforations, thereby preventing pooling and waterlogging in your lawn.

In regions like South Vancouver, where heavy rainfall can create significant drainage challenges, French drains prove invaluable. They are particularly effective in areas prone to flooding, such as near foundations or low-lying garden beds. Their versatility makes them suitable for various landscapes, and they can be installed in both residential yards and commercial properties.

During the installation of a French drain system, ensuring that the pipe slopes correctly is crucial for facilitating effective water flow. Many homeowners have successfully utilised this type of drainage solution to manage excess water and prevent erosion. This system helps maintain the integrity of your lawn while promoting healthier grass growth by minimising water pooling that can lead to disease.

What Is the Functionality of Dry Wells in Drainage Systems?

Dry wells offer another effective drainage solution, particularly in regions experiencing heavy rainfall. These systems collect and store surplus water underground, allowing it to slowly seep into the soil over time, effectively reducing surface water accumulation.

For homeowners in South Vancouver, dry wells can be a practical solution for managing water runoff from roofs, driveways, or other impervious surfaces that do not absorb water. During heavy rainfalls, a dry well can prevent flooding by temporarily housing excess water until the surrounding soil can absorb it.

Installation typically involves excavating a deep pit and filling it with gravel or stone to create a permeable barrier. Some homeowners opt to connect dry wells to existing drainage systems to enhance their effectiveness. Regular maintenance and monitoring are crucial to ensure that dry wells remain functional, as sediment can accumulate over time and impede water flow. With proper attention, homeowners can enjoy a more efficient drainage system that minimises the risk of lawn damage while contributing to a more sustainable landscape.

Channel Drains: An Effective Approach to Surface Water Management

Channel drains serve as an exceptionally efficient method for managing surface water in lawns and other outdoor areas. These drains consist of a grated trench that collects and redirects surface water away from problem areas, effectively preventing water accumulation. The design allows these drains to handle large volumes of water quickly, making them an ideal choice for areas prone to flooding.

In South Vancouver, where heavy rain can lead to rapid water buildup, channel drains provide a convenient and effective drainage solution. They can be installed in various locations around the property, including driveways, patios, and garden beds, ensuring that excess water is directed away from your home and into designated drainage areas.

The ease of maintenance associated with channel drains is another significant advantage. The grates can be easily removed for cleaning, allowing homeowners to swiftly address any debris that may clog the system. Regular maintenance ensures that the drains operate effectively, minimising the risk of water pooling and the resulting damage.

Examining the Role of Sump Pumps in Comprehensive Drainage Solutions

Sump pumps are critical components of effective lawn drainage systems, especially in areas vulnerable to waterlogging. Installed in a pit below ground level, sump pumps collect excess water that accumulates in the area and pump it out, typically directing it away from the home or lawn. This mechanism is essential for maintaining optimal soil moisture levels and protecting lawns from prolonged saturation.

In South Vancouver, where heavy rainfall is a frequent occurrence, sump pumps can be invaluable in preventing flooding. Homeowners often find that installing a sump pump provides peace of mind, particularly during the rainy season when water accumulation is most likely to occur.

Selecting the right sump pump for your property is crucial since different models offer varying capabilities and power sources. Regular maintenance, including inspection and cleaning, is necessary to ensure that the sump pump operates efficiently. With proper care, sump pumps can significantly extend the life of your lawn while reducing the risk of water damage to nearby structures.

What Are Effective Cleaning and Maintenance Strategies for Longevity?

Regular cleaning and maintenance are vital for ensuring your drainage system operates efficiently. Start by keeping all drains free of debris, including leaves, dirt, and grass clippings, which can obstruct water flow and lead to backups. Homeowners should routinely check surface drains and channel drains for signs of clogs and promptly remove any visible obstructions.

It is also essential to verify that proper grading is maintained around your property. Over time, soil can shift, and areas may settle or erode, affecting the efficacy of your drainage system. Ensuring that the land slopes away from structures will help direct water toward designated drainage areas.

Establishing a maintenance schedule can facilitate this process. Consider conducting a thorough check of your drainage system at least twice a year, ideally in spring and fall. By adhering to these strategies, homeowners can extend the lifespan of their drainage systems and maintain a healthy lawn.
